by Jessica Yellin

Be noisy. Natalie Savage grew up hearing these remarks from her adoring father, Walter Cronkite, who so liked him that he named the family dog after him. Natalie, who spent her twenties missing out on life's milestones, suddenly finds her efforts rewarded when she is assigned to cover the White House for ATN. What is the issue? The job is just temporary, and it's a test to determine if she's up to the task. To achieve success, she has always relied on her tenacity, convictions, and common sense. But now she's up against a 26-year-old privileged frat guy who got his big break on television by eating raw animal parts on a reality program. Of course, he'll come out on top.

In order to establish herself, Natalie and her scrappy production crew must negotiate ratings battles, workplace sexual harassment, and a worldwide political catastrophe. But the closer she gets to her ideal career, the more she questions if all the sacrifices are worth it.
